Load Rating Clarity: What You Need to Know
One of the most common questions AutoZone support receives is: What does the load rating mean? The load rating refers to the maximum weight the jack stand can safely support when used correctly. AutoZone Memphis Stand Supports are rated in tons: 2-ton, 3-ton, 4-ton, and 5-ton models are available. These ratings are not arbitrarythey are determined through standardized testing per ANSI/ASME B30.20, which requires each stand to withstand 150% of its rated capacity without permanent deformation.
For example, a 3-ton jack stand must support up to 9,000 pounds (3 tons x 1.5) during testing. This safety margin ensures that even under unexpected stress, the stand remains functional. However, users must never exceed the labeled rating. A 3-ton stand should never hold a 4-ton vehicleeven if the vehicle appears to be just under the limit. Weight distribution, center of gravity, and suspension load all affect the actual force applied to the stand.
AutoZones support team helps customers match their vehicles curb weight and payload to the correct stand model. They also advise on using multiple stands for added safetynever relying on a single stand for heavy or uneven loads.

Q3: How do I know if my jack stand is still safe to use?
A: Inspect for cracks, bent components, worn threads, or loose pins. If the base is rusted through or the locking mechanism doesnt engage firmly, replace it immediately. AutoZone recommends replacing stands every 5 years or after any visible damage.
Q4: Do I need to use two jack stands or can I use one?
A: Always use at least two jack stands when lifting a vehicle. Never rely on a single stand. For added safety, use four standstwo at the front and two at the rear.
